To efficiently navigate the business landscape in the state of Wyoming, conducting a Wyoming entity search is a critical step for anyone interested in create a company or verifying the status of an existing entity. The Wyoming Secretary of State provides an web-based tool that enables users to access comprehensive information about incorporated businesses, such as their formation details, status, and any associated filings. This resource is invaluable for business owners and investors who need to confirm that a business is legally compliant and active before entering into any contracts or investments.

When using the Wyoming's entity search, users can enter various criteria, including the name of the business or entity number, to filter results. This feature enables quick recognition of particular entities and helps avoid any confusion with similarly businesses. Once the results are generated, users can deeper explore the information provided, which typically includes the entity's formation date, registered agent, and present standing with the state. Accessing this information can prevent potential business disputes and promote informed decision-making.

The Florida entity search is an essential resource for anyone seeking to explore the state's commercial landscape. This online resource provides access to important information about various business entities registered in Florida, including corp entities, partnership firms, and LLCs. By using the Florida entity search, entrepreneurs, stakeholders, and business professionals can obtain essential details such as status of registration, company address, and the identities of executives or agents. This openness helps individuals make informed decisions before engaging in business activities.

When conducting a Florida entity search, users can easily visit the official state Department of Corporations website, where the search functionality allows for multiple queries. People can search by name, document number, or even the name of a registered agent. This adaptability helps streamline the investigation, enabling users to locate specific companies or verify the legitimacy of a firm. Ensuring that a company is properly registered and compliant with state regulations is crucial, and the entity search serves as a critical initial step in this verification.
